Anyways, lets talk torque settings.

TC to flywheel, and the bolts holding the box on if possible. :)

Quote
Mount transmission on engine and attach to cylinder block with transmission fastening bolts (M12) – tightening torque 60 Nm / 44.3 lbf. ft.

Install transmission fastening bolts (M8) to upper part of oil pan – tightening torque 20 Nm / 15 lbf. ft.

Detach transmission from workshop crane.

Attach torque converter to drive disc – tightening torque 30 Nm / 22 lbf. ft. Install closure plugs for torque converter housing.

Make sure the torque converter is fully back into the bellhousing before fitting (it should rub on the bell housing when turned).

Should say- the above is for a V6. Couldn't find equivalent info for the TD but if the fasteners are the same size I'd use the same settings.
